Fonar Corporation announced its financial results for the third quarter of fiscal 2025, revealing a 6% increase in Total Revenues-Net to $27.2 million for the quarter ended March 31, 2025, compared to $25.7 million in the same quarter of the previous year. Net Income saw a notable rise of 25%, reaching $3.1 million for the quarter, up from $2.48 million the year before. Additionally, Diluted Net Income Per Common Share Available to Common Stockholders increased by 37% to $0.37 per share from $0.27 per share in the prior year's quarter. Income from Operations experienced a slight decrease of 2%, totaling $3.7 million compared to $3.8 million in the corresponding quarter of the previous year. The company also reported a decrease in Total Cash, Cash Equivalents, and Short-Term Investments by 4%, standing at $54.4 million as of March 31, 2025, down from $56.67 million as of June 30, 2024. Fonar's diagnostic imaging management subsidiary, Health Management Company of America $(HMCA.UK)$, set a new company record by completing 54,612 MRI scans in the third quarter, marking a 2.8% increase from the previous quarter and a 3.4% increase compared to the same quarter in fiscal 2024. Over the nine-month period, HMCA achieved a record 160,780 MRI scans, a 3.9% rise from 154,790 scans in the corresponding period of the previous year.
